Tall Centrepieces: Go Big or Go Home?

Tall centrepieces are designed to make an entrance. Think slim gold stands topped with orchids, cascading florals suspended above the table, glass cylinders with floating candles, or sculptural branches carrying tiny warm lights.

They work particularly well in spacious banquet halls across Delhi NCR and Gurgaon, where a larger ceiling height gives the arrangement room to breathe. A tall installation can draw the eye upward, add grandeur and make a standard dining setup feel considerably more luxurious.

But there is one golden rule: keep the base visually light.

A massive floral arrangement sitting directly in front of guests is not a centrepiece. It is a conversation blocker.

Choose narrow stands, elevated structures or transparent vessels so guests can still see each other. Nobody wants to spend dinner shouting across a rose bush.

 

Low Centrepieces: Understated, Not Underwhelming

Low centrepieces offer a completely different personality. Picture clusters of seasonal flowers, brass bowls with floating candles, miniature floral arrangements, textured ceramic vessels or a carefully styled combination of candles and foliage.

They are ideal for intimate receptions, round tables and venues where guest interaction matters. They also photograph beautifully from multiple angles because the table remains visually connected rather than divided by a towering arrangement.

This is where restraint becomes a luxury.

Instead of filling the table with ten different decorative elements, use three or four strong ones. A low floral runner with votive candles and a textured table linen can look more sophisticated than an arrangement trying to include every flower available in Delhi’s wholesale market.

 

The Venue Should Have a Vote

This is where a professional decorator in Delhi earns their keep.

A tall centrepiece may look spectacular in a Pinterest image but completely wrong in a venue with low ceilings. Similarly, a tiny low arrangement can disappear inside a cavernous Gurgaon ballroom.

Table diameter matters too. Tall arrangements suit larger round tables where the vertical element balances the width. Long banquet tables can benefit from repeated low clusters, creating rhythm without turning the dining area into an obstacle course.

 

Think About the Photos

Wedding decor is no longer experienced only in person. It lives in photographs, reels and approximately 47 family WhatsApp groups.

Tall centrepieces can create dramatic vertical frames, especially when paired with chandeliers or hanging installations. Low arrangements create cleaner sightlines and let the table setting, stationery, glassware and candlelight become part of the photograph.

Your wedding decorator Delhi team should therefore consider how the centrepiece interacts with the entire visual composition, not treat it as an isolated floral decision.

Choose tall centrepieces when you want drama, height and a luxury ballroom feel. Choose low centrepieces when you want intimacy, conversation and a more editorial aesthetic.
